Stuffed intestines

Stuffed intestines (Armenian: փոր լցոնած or դալակ դոլմա, Arabic: فوارغ) is a dish of Armenian origin that is often called dalak dolma or keebah. The main ingredients are minced meat, cow or lamb intestines, bulgur, dried mint, onion, chickpeas, salt, black pepper, allspice, and cinnamon.[1]
